The 2009 HONK! festival kicked off yesterday around the Greater Boston area. 30 activist street bands decended on Somerville and parts of Boston. I spent the afternoon on Friday at the Boys and Girls Club in Dudley Square and then joined the party in Davis Square today. The bands come from around the world and raise awareness about the importance of music as well as carrying anti-war, pro-health care messages.
